This article will explain the meaning of money muling, how to spot one, and how to protect yourself.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>What Is a Money Mule?<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">A money mule is someone who transfers stolen money on behalf of criminals. They may knowingly or unknowingly help move funds from scams, cyber fraud, or other illegal activities. These people often think they&#8217;re doing legitimate work or helping someone in need. But they&#8217;re actually helping criminals launder stolen money and hide their tracks. Money mules make it harder for police to trace where the stolen funds came from or where they went.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Who Are Money Mules in Banking?<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><b>Fake Job Offers<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">: Criminals often post fake job offers promising easy money for simple tasks that seem legitimate but involve illegal money transfers.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Part-Time Remote Work: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> They also target people with part-time remote work opportunities that appear genuine but are designed to exploit victims.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Investment and Crypto Schemes: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Investment and cryptocurrency schemes are another common trap used to recruit unsuspecting money mules into illegal activities.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Romance Scams: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Romance scams on dating apps and social media also attract victims into these criminal operations through emotional manipulation.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Target Demographics: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Students and homemakers are frequently targeted because they may need extra income and trust these false opportunities.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>How Money Mule Scams Work?<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><b>Step 1: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Victims are approached online with attractive job or earning offers that seem legitimate and easy.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Step 2: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">They are asked to receive money in their personal bank account for supposed business purposes.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Step 3: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Victims are told to forward this money to another account, often international or anonymous locations.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Step 4: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Criminals use the victim&#8217;s identity to launder stolen money through these seemingly innocent transactions.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Step 5: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">When law enforcement discovers these transactions, they flag the accounts involved. Unfortunately, the innocent mule gets blamed while the real criminals escape.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Real-Life Examples of Money Muling in India<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><b>Mass Banking Fraud: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> CBI discovered 850,000 fake accounts across 743 bank branches. Criminals used forged documents to open these accounts. Bank staff helped create the accounts. Money was moved quickly through these accounts to hide its source.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Village Victim: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> A Haryana villager received trading tips and let someone use his bank account. The fraudster scammed a woman using his account. Police froze the innocent villager&#8217;s account and investigated him instead.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Shell Company Network: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Officials found 145 accounts linked to 10 fake companies. These mule accounts processed \u20b93,200 crore in eight months.
